DCA has just delivered a cutting-edge, fully automated 8-inch wafer production system to La Luce Cristallina in Austin, TX USA.

La Luce Cristallina is advancing the frontier of Silicon Photonics by integrating crystalline oxides like Barium Titanate (BTO) to enable high-performance electro-optic modulators – a key technology for future photonic applications including optical interconnects, sensing, and computing.

 

🔬 The system features:

  • Fully automated UHV system with precision robot wafer handling.
  • Dual process chambers for STO (via MBE) and BTO (via UHV sputtering).
  • Rapid cassette sample loading (10×8”) and UHV cassette storage (10×8”).

 

💡 Highlights:

  • MBE Chamber: Equipped with dual e-beam evaporators for STO growth, cooled by an ethanol-based cryo system (-40°C) to reduce LN₂ dependency.
  • Sputtering Chamber: Features dual APEX-L linear magnetrons for uniform BTO deposition.
